McLaren Health Care Launches AI-Powered Cardiac Screening

McLaren Health Care has partnered with Bunkerhill Health to launch a first-of-its-kind cardiovascular screening program in Michigan. By utilizing AI technology, the system identifies early signs of heart disease in patients using data from routine chest CT scans already on file.

Key Highlights of the Program

  • AI-Driven Detection: The program uses the Carebricks platform and FDA-cleared algorithms to identify incidental coronary artery calcium (iCAC) and aortic valve calcium (iAVC) from scans originally performed for other reasons (e.g., lung cancer screenings or infections).
  • Early Intervention: This technology allows clinicians to catch heart disease and aortic stenosis before symptoms appear, bypassing the need for specialized, time-consuming cardiac imaging.
  • Efficiency for Clinicians: The AI handles chart reviews and determines patient eligibility for follow-up based on clinical guidelines, reducing the administrative burden on medical staff.
  • National Leadership: McLaren is one of only five health systems in the U.S. (joining the likes of Mayo Clinic and Cleveland Clinic) to deploy AI-powered aortic valve calcium detection.

Impact and Reach

“By using the clinical information already available to us, this program enables us to identify patients who may benefit from earlier follow-up… helping to close critical gaps in detection.” — Dr. Samer Kazziha, Chief Medical Director, McLaren Heart & Vascular Institute.

Based in Grand Blanc, Michigan, McLaren Health Care operates 12 hospitals and a massive network of providers. This initiative aims to combat heart disease—the leading cause of death—by turning existing clinical data into actionable preventive care.
